Hi All,
I have a problem for the CME configuration.
A end user ephone (CP7965G) have 2 DN, 1st line is end user no. , the 2nd line is boss sharded line.
When the end user using line 1 (1st phone line active in this time), a new call calling to his boss, the 2nd line is flashing but didn't ring.
I understand when I using CUCM just set the "Ring Setting (Phone Active)" to "ring" in the boss line,
but in CME, how can I allow the 2nd line ringing in CME command?

Hi Ivan,
You may be seeing this behavior;
All phones sharing the common directory number can initate and receive calls at the same time. Calls to
the mixed shared line ring simultaneously on all phones without active calls and any of these phones can
answer the incoming calls.
